CORTLAND - Fredonia State lost both women's volleyball matches Saturday on the second day of the Cortland Red Dragon Classic, yet not before putting up a stubborn performance at the end of the day.

The Blue Devils (1-3) fell to Rowan 3-1 in the first match and to Nazareth 3-0 in the second.

The Nazareth match concluded within an epic 39-37 third-set defeat. The Blue Devils lost the first two sets 25-20 and 25-18.

Against Rowan, the Blue Devils fell by identical 25-21 scores in the first two sets, won the third set 25-14, then dropped the deciding fifth set 25-22.

Senior outside hitter Lindsey Olson was the team leader with 12 kills and 11 digs. Freshman middle blocker Jessica DiChristopher added 11 kills and two block assists, and freshman middle blocker/outside hitter Meredith Smietana finished with 10 kills one solo block, and one block assist.

Freshman setter Kelly Edinger was the top playmaker with 31 assists, plus one solo block and one block assist. Freshman opposite Paulina Rein added 10 digs, and junior libero/outside hitter Lauren O'Hara was credited with two service aces.

In the Nazareth match, Olsen recorded 16 kills and nine digs.Edinger had 31 assists and 13 digs. Freshman defensive specialist Lauren Hokaj also had 13 digs and Rein registered for service aces.

Fredonia State and Nazareth will stage a rematch Friday in the first day of the Nazareth invitational. The Blue Devils will also meet Cortland, Mount Union, and Clarkson over the two days.

Lightning delay ends in 'no contest'

ROANOKE, Va. - Fredonia State's women's soccer game vs. No. 15 Lynchburg was declared a "no contest" Saturday when officials ruled the game would not be restarted after a lenghty lightning delay.

The game was called in the 57th minute with Lynchburg in the lead. An NCAA soccer game is not official until it reaches the 70th minute.
